1. Plan and Research in Advance:
One of the most crucial steps when traveling on a budget is to plan your trip well in advance. This allows you to take advantage of the best deals and discounts while ensuring that you organize your trip efficiently. Research your destination thoroughly to find affordable accommodations, local transportation options, and free or low-cost activities to enjoy. Utilize budget travel websites, forums, and apps to find the best deals on flights, accommodations, and attractions.

2. Travel in the Off-Season:
Consider traveling during the off-peak season. Choosing to venture to your dream destination during less popular times of the year can result in significant savings. Not only will you experience fewer crowds, but you can also find reduced prices for accommodations, flights, and activities. Additionally, traveling during the shoulder season, which is the period between peak and off-peak seasons, often allows you to enjoy pleasant weather and reasonable prices.

3. Embrace Alternative Accommodations:
While luxury hotels may be appealing, they can also consume a significant portion of your travel budget. Opt for alternative accommodations to save money. Consider staying in hostels, where you can meet fellow travelers and enjoy a vibrant social atmosphere. Another budget-friendly option is Airbnb, which provides unique and affordable housing options, allowing you to experience the local culture more intimately.

4. Cook Your Own Meals:
One of the most significant expenses while traveling is dining out. Eating at restaurants for every meal can quickly drain your budget. Instead, embrace the local markets and supermarkets, and cook your own meals whenever possible. Not only is this a cost-effective option, but it also allows you to experiment with local ingredients and flavors. An occasional splurge on a local delicacy won’t break the bank and can enhance your overall culinary experience.

5. Utilize Public Transportation:
Public transportation is often the most economical way to get around in a new city or country. Buses, trams, and underground networks are not only cheaper than taxis or rental cars but also offer a more authentic experience. Research transportation passes or cards that provide unlimited travel for a specific time frame and use them to explore the city at your own pace.

6. Seek Free or Low-Cost Activities:
Every destination has a plethora of free or low-cost activities waiting to be explored. Take advantage of museums that offer free entry on certain days, wander through local parks and landmarks, or immerse yourself in the local culture at festivals or events. City walking tours with knowledgeable guides can also be a fantastic way to learn about the history and hidden gems of your destination without breaking the bank.

7. Pack Light:
Traveling light saves you money in various ways. Firstly, you save on baggage fees when flying with budget airlines. Secondly, having only a carry-on bag allows you to walk or use public transportation more easily, eliminating the need for expensive taxis or shuttles. Lastly, packing light reduces the risk of misplacing or losing your belongings, saving you replacement costs.
